1. Resize does not preserve the alpha channel of 32bit PNG images (in a PNG-to-PNG conversion) and does not inform for the loss of it.
2. The status bar ignores the alpha channel of 32bit PNG images - it does not indicate in any way the existence of alpha channel in the selected image.

Thanks for pointing this.

Tools -> Options -> General -> Read/Write -> Read -> PNG -> Compose image with alpha (32bits) was checked. By default this option is not checked in XnView v1.97.8. It appears that XnView used settings from previous installation.

I'm having the same problem resizing PNG's. The alpha layer just turns black for any resample type other than "bilinear" or "nearest neighbor" (and those produce pixelated images that don't look good).
I tried enabling/disabling the "Option/Read/PNG/Compose ...." in every combination. I can't even perform a color depth "transformation" and retain the alpha layer. Am I doing something wrong? I've tried this with xnConvert as well with no luck.
